v2.14 — Defaults changed following the Ostermark stale-cache postmortem. Cache entries for the Pricefeed service previously had no max TTL, which let a bad invalidation path serve week-old quotes. New defaults: hard TTL cap, background refresh enabled, and negative-result caching shortened. If you're onboarding, read the postmortem doc before touching cache code; these defaults exist for a reason and overrides now require a review. Deployments pick these up automatically. The shipped defaults are as follows.

config for hahaf-kafof:
[wenys]
host = wenys.torvahq.corp
user = wenys_svc
database = wenys_prod

**Ticket: Snapshot test coverage for Larchbox UI kit**

Scope: add snapshot tests for the Button, Drawer, and StatusChip components. Use the existing harness in the kit repo; do not add new tooling. Update stale snapshots only with justification in the PR description. Contractor note: generated snapshot files must not be hand-edited. Work is blocked until sign-off is recorded. Sign-off required from the person named below.

named custodian: Brivan Eliath Quenox Frador

Canary gating on the Lanewick pipeline failed this branch twice, so flagging for review. The rule set requires error-rate delta under 0.5% across two consecutive five-minute windows before promotion; our change to the Orvane ingest handler tripped the latency gate instead, which also blocks rollout. I adjusted the gate config to exclude the warmup window per the platform team's guidance, and re-ran. Promotion now passes cleanly. The passing canary run is recorded under the token below.

session token of bawep-yadup = htk21_528abd376e3c5a4ec24a1

Runbook: leaked file descriptor hunt (Ferrowatch ingest). If fd counts on an ingest pod climb past 80% of the ulimit, capture lsof output twice, five minutes apart, and diff for growth in pipe or socket entries. Most leaks trace to the retry path in the feed poller. Log your findings in the incident table, reachable with the connection string below.

replica DSN, kajep-yahag: mssql://praok_svc:iF@db-8d68.plorvaio.local:5432/eliion